Ford's new side-view system simplifies mirror adjustments

Ford has filed a patent for an enhanced side-view system that could feature in future vehicles. The system would let drivers control side mirrors using the turn signal stalk, making it easy to extend or retract them based on driving conditions.

Drivers can enable or disable this function. If they choose to use it, they can preset mirror positions, save them, and then switch between settings with a single button press.

This feature would be particularly useful for those who frequently tow trailers. Ford notes in the patent that the system can automatically detect when side mirror adjustments are needed.

About three years ago, Ford published a patent for adjustable towing mirrors. Those used a trailer angle sensor and adjustable viewing windows to help monitor trailer movement when driving forward or in reverse.

As Ford pointed out in that patent, it can sometimes be difficult or even impossible to see where a trailer is going if it's positioned at certain angles, forcing users to adjust mirrors manually.
